  • Specifications:

    • Signal Format: PAL/NTSC
    • Image Sensor: 1/4'' SONY CCD
    • Effective Pixels: PAL:512(H)×582(V)    NTSC: 512(H)×492(V)
    • Scanning System: NTSC: 525Lines, 60 Field/Sec, PAL: 625 Lines, 50Field/Sec
    • Sync System: Internal synchronization
    • Resolution: 420TV lines
    • S/N Ratio: More than 48dB(AGC Off)
    • Gamma Characteristic: 0.48
    • Illumination Sensitivity: 0.5 Lux@F:2.0(D:0.5lux, N:0.05lux)
    • Gain Control: Auto
    • B.L.C.: Auto
    • White Balance: ON
    • Electronic Shutter Speed: 1/50(1/60) -1/100,000 second
    • Video Output: 1.0Vp-p,75Ω
    • Power Supply: DC12V
    • Current Consumption: 100mA ± 10%
    • Operating Temperature: -10℃ - +50℃
    • Storage Temperature: -20℃ - +60℃
    • Infraed Lamps: 45m
    • LED Number: Φ8  30PCS

  • What is a infrared camera?
  • An infrared camera is one in which the light-sensitive medium is sensitized to infrared wavelengths. It has a wide range of artistic and scientific applications. It can record images by reflected infrared light, including heat signatures. For example, chlorophyll is a strong reflector of infrared, so leafy trees produce a strong exposure in infrared, resulting in very bright leaves instead of dark ones seen in normal light. The photographic effect can be eery, but such imagery can also be used to show the state of health of large areas of vegetation. On a hot day, the cars in a parking lot leave shadows in the heat of the dark pavement, which can be photographed with infrared long after all the cars are gone.

  • Why use an Infrared Camera?
  • 1. Infrared cameras are the latest technology being used for fast, reliable, accurate building diagnosis in the entire range of building problems, from post-catastrophe fire and flood investigations to chronic leaks and moisture problems.
    2. Moisture in building materials can destroy structural integrity and nurture mold. The first step in moisture problem remediation is to quickly and accurately locate and remove all sources of moisture. By finding variations in temperature, Infrared cameras instantly show you what's wet and what's dry.
